啮合型异向旋转双螺杆挤出机熔体输送流场及特性的近似解析解

摘    要:从简化的物理模型和数学模型出发,参照流速分布数值计算结果所反映出的规律性,求出了C形小室内熔体流速分布的近似解析解,并由此导出了熔体输送段中产生的轴向力、扭矩、功耗和比功耗的计算公式。与数值计算得出的结果相比,这些公式由于具有解析形式,不但能直观地反映上述熔体输送特性参数与其他参数的关系,而且更便于运用。

Approximate Solutions for Melt-conveying Flow Field and Melt-conveying Performances of a Closely Intermeshing Counter - rotating Twin-screw Extruder

Abstract:Based on simplified theoretical models and previous numerical results of velocity distributions,the approximate analytical solutions for the velocity distributions of the melts in a C-shaped chamber has been worked out in this paper.Thereupon.the analytical expressions for calculating the axial force,torque,power consumption and reduce power consumption are derived. Comparing with the numerical results,these expressions,owing to their analytical form,can not only represent directly the relations between the above-mentioned performance parameters and the related factors,but also be used conveniently.
